  • Title

    A permanent magnet synchronous generator with variable speed input for co-generation system

  • Abstract
    A novel distributed power generation system that includes a variable speed engine, a generator with an almost proportional output power to the input and a power conversion system (PCS) is presented as a cogeneration system of medium capacity application for the purpose of energy saving control with the advantage of connection to a power distribution line. The widespread utilization of general internal combustion engines, such as diesel engines and rotary engines, allows generators for utility use to be configured with constant speed rotating machines. A high-efficiency cogeneration system can be constructed by driving the permanent magnet synchronous generator (PMG) and the directly connected engine at variable speed. The characteristics of the proposed generator and the experimental results of a test module of the system are provided to validate the proposed configuration and the control method
